PAX East 2022 Badges On Sale Later Today

PAX East 2022 Badges On Sale Later Today

Join the Game Industry Reunion at PAX’s Return to Boston

Boston — 14 Dec. 2021 — PAX East 2022 badges go on sale later today at 3:00 PM ET / 12:00 PM PT, show organizers ReedPop and Penny Arcade announce. The East Coast’s most attended gaming event returns for an in-person show at the Boston Convention and Exhibition Center (BCEC) from Thursday, 21 April 2022 to Sunday, 24 April 2022.

Both single-day badges, for $62, and four-day badges for $235 will be available later today on the PAX East website. PAX East will return with a massive show floor featuring hundreds of publishers, developers, and vendors, to be announced in the coming months leading up to the show.

Additionally, attendees can expect a full weekend of panels, live shows from Penny Arcade, esports competitions in the PAX Arena and concerts featuring video game-inspired music. PAX East will also provide an opportunity for the community to come together with tournaments, tabletop lounges, and freeplay sections featuring PC, console, and retro games.

After canceling 2021’s show for the health and safety of the community, and successfully hosting safe events with Seattle’s PAX West and Philadelphia’s PAX Unplugged, PAX East will require mandatory proof of vaccination and face coverings for all attendees, exhibitors, and guests in the BCEC. Additional health and safety information will be shared on the PAX East website in the leadup to the event.

“With an incredible PAX Unplugged in the rearview, we turn our sights to Boston – wicked Boston, the site of a most powerful ritual,” said Jerry Holkins, co-founder of Penny Arcade and PAX. “After seeing the community safely come together in Seattle and Philadelphia, the stars are right. Rise, PAX East; Rise!”

Four-day PAX East 2022 badges are now on sale for $235, while individual Thursday, Friday, Saturday, and Sunday badges will go for $62 each.

Those interested in hosting a panel at PAX East can submit their ideas starting January 3. Media registration opens up today for interested journalists and content creators who wish to cover the show.

About PAX

PAX, or Penny Arcade Expo, is a festival for gamers to celebrate gaming culture. First held in Seattle in 2004, PAX has nearly doubled in size each successive year, with PAX Prime 2014 selling out of tickets in a matter of minutes. Connecting the world’s leading game publishers with their most avid and influential fans, PAX expanded with a second show in Boston in 2010, and a third in San Antonio in 2015, making it the three largest gaming shows in North America. The first international PAX was held in Melbourne, Australia in 2013. In 2017, Penny Arcade established PAX Unplugged, its first tabletop focused show, held in Philadelphia.

Asteroids™: Recharged Explodes onto Switch, PlayStation, Xbox, PC, VCS Today

Asteroids™: Recharged Explodes onto Switch, PlayStation, Xbox, PC, VCS Today

1980’s Arcade Classic Hyperspace Warps into the 21st Century with a Modern Touch

NEW YORK — Dec 14, 2021 — Asteroids: Recharged, the modern co-op revival of the definitive arcade shooter from Atari®, made in collaboration with developers Adamvision Studios and SneakyBox Studios, blasts onto the scene and is now available on Nintendo Switch, PlayStation 5 and 4, Xbox Series X|S and One, Atari VCS, and PC for Steam and Epic Games Store.

Asteroids: Recharged is the latest Atari title to receive a modern refresh, following behind Centipede: Recharged and Black Widow: Recharged, and preceding 2022’s Breakout: Recharged. Known for its zero-gravity controls and surprise alien invasions, the highly influential 1979 space shooter Asteroids was arguably the original arcade high-score hunting ground, with the first high score leaderboard with the ability to enter one’s initials. 

Return to the roots of 1980’s top-grossing arcade game and Atari 2600 best seller while piloting through giant asteroids. Blast rocks into pieces and take down aliens to earn high scores with just one life on the global leaderboards. Play solo or with a friend in couch co-op, perfect for Steam Remote Play and PlayStation Share Play. Test rock-smashing skills in more than two dozen Challenges introducing tricky scenarios testing even Asteroids masters.

While staying true to the original “thrust forward and shoot” play style, Asteroids: Recharged ups the intensity with new powerups such as Side Shots, Rapid Fire, Mega Lasers, and a handy reflector in case a flying saucer sneaks its way into play. And if space gets too crowded, use the ultimate risk-reward “hyperspace” button to teleport to a random spot on screen.

Asteroids: Recharged doesn’t just stand in the shadow of the past, but defines its own style with new vibrant visuals. Gameplay takes full advantage of modern widescreen displays with support for high refresh rates on PC, PlayStation 5, and Xbox Series X|S, all complemented by a modern upbeat synthwave soundtrack from award-winning composer Megan McDuffee. 

“The simplicity of Asteroids is what makes it easy to learn, yet difficult to master,” said Wade Rosen, CEO, Atari. “We’re looking forward to bringing the old-school arcade action of the classic to a new audience with Asteroids: Recharged, as well as giving veterans to showcase their skills. It’s just like riding a bike, right?”

Asteroids: Recharged is now available on the Nintendo Switch, Xbox One, Xbox Series X|S, PlayStation 4, PlayStation 5, Steam and Epic Games Store for Windows PC, and the Atari VCS for $9.99. The Atari VCS versions each feature exclusive content and are optimized to work with the new Atari Wireless Classic Joystick. 

Asteroids: Recharged supports English, French, Italian, German, Spanish, Brazilian Portuguese, Russian, Japanese, Korean, and simplified and traditional Chinese language text.

Tom Clancy’s Rainbow Six Siege’s Wintry Snow Brawl Event Launches Tomorrow

Tom Clancy’s Rainbow Six® Siege’s Wintry Snow Brawl Event Launches Tomorrow

From tomorrow until January 5, players can enjoy a cool twist on a snowball fight

SYDNEY, AUSTRALIA – December 14, 2021 Today, Ubisoft® announced a new limited-time event for Tom Clancy’s Rainbow Six® Siege, Snow Brawl, beginning tomorrow and running for three weeks until January 5. Snow Brawl introduces a snow-filled capture the flag game mode, where players must capture the flag of the opposing team and bring it back to their own base to score a point.

Equipped with unlimited snowballs as their main weapon and the Snowblast Launcher as secondary, players will enjoy a chilling fight in a revisited Chalet map. Flags can be released by the holder or by taking down the carrier, and fallen flags can be returned to base by picking them up. Three hits down a player and sends them to Respawn. Boosts available on the map include: running speed, rate of fire, air jab ammo, and health packs. The team with the most points at the end of the 10-minute round wins – in case of a tie, overtime begins, with the first team to score in Sudden Death wins.

In Snow Brawl, players can fight as The Blue Blades with Operators Ash, Blackbeard, Buck, Montagne, and Osa or The Orange Blizzard with Operators Castle, Frost, Rook, Thorn, and Vigil.

The Snow Brawl Collection comes with 45 wintry items including uniforms, headgear, matching weapon skins, and Operator card portraits for those in The Orange Blizzards and The Blue Blades. Snow Brawl also introduces the Snowflake Bundle with includes a signature weapon skin, a universal attachment skin, charm, and background. The Snow Brawl Collection packs can be obtained by completing the special Event Challenges, or by purchasing them for 300 R6 Credits, or 12,500 Renown. One free Collection pack will be gifted to all players who log into the game during the Snow Brawl event, and one additional per week as they complete the weekly challenges. The Collection items can also be purchased as individual bundles for 1680 R6 Credits.

About Tom Clancy’s Rainbow Six Siege 

Alongside a thriving professional esports scene and a community of over 75 million registered players, Tom Clancy’s Rainbow Six Siege puts players in the middle of a fast-paced, ever-evolving multiplayer experience grounded in the selection of unique Operators. Using the right mix of tactics and destruction, Rainbow Six teams engage their enemies in sieges, where both sides have exclusive skills and gadgets at their disposal. Defenders prepare by transforming the environments around them into modern strongholds, while attackers use recon drones to gain intel for carefully planning their assault. With access to dozens of Operators inspired by real world counter-intelligence agents from around the globe, players can choose exactly how they want to approach each challenge they encounter. Through the constant addition of new Operators and maps that add to the depth of both strategy and combat, the unpredictability of each round of Rainbow Six Siege sets a new bar for intensity and competition in gaming.

Australian game development industry doubles revenue to $226 million over the past five years

The industry recorded over 20% year on year growth for the past three years due to the increasing popularity of video games

SYDNEY, AUSTRALIA, 14 December 2021 – The Australian video game development industry doubled its revenue to $226 million since 2016, according to results from the fifth annual Australian Game Development Survey (AGDS) 2021 released today from video games industry body the Interactive Games & Entertainment Association (IGEA). The survey measures the size of the Australian game development industry and revealed that the industry expects further growth locally, contributing to the growth of the global market, which was worth $AU240 billion in 2020.

“Five years ago, the Australian game development industry achieved $114 million in revenue and has grown exponentially since then to record over $226 million the last financial year,” said IGEA CEO Ron Curry. “The figures prove the potential and adaptability of the globally reputable Australian video games industry, and we need to capitalise on this experience while we can.”

The survey shows that over the past three years, the Australian game development industry has recorded year-on-year revenue growth of over 20%, with 2021 generating an increase of 23%, coupled with employment growth of 7%. Employment has grown by over 50% since 2016 to 1,327 full-time workers in the industry. 2021 has seen a vast improvement in gender diversity across the workforce. 23% of employees are (cisgender) female while 10% are transgender, non-binary, or gender diverse – a testament to the recruiting and talent attraction programs being implemented by Australian game development businesses.

However, Australian game developers’ most significant challenge is employment-related, with many developers still having difficulty attracting early-stage funding or accessing appropriate government funding. The main issue for employers currently is hiring employees with specialised skills; the global demand for experienced staff, closed borders and unfavourable migration programs are the main contributors to this. Additionally, Australia suffered a significant brain drain following the GFC, with many Australian skilled workers continuing to live and thrive in studios overseas.

Recent Federal Government support through the 30% Digital Games Tax Offset (DGTO) to be introduced in July 2022 provides the promise of game development reviving Australia’s economy, which has spurned additional State Government rebates in NSW and QLD. This injection of confidence from the Australian Government has encouraged multinational studios and investors to step up their activities locally and explore options to establish studios in Australia, creating the jobs needed to entice specialised workers back home or consider Australia a place to work.

“The support from the Federal Government is the engine that will drive Australian video game development to become a billion-dollar industry,” said Curry. “The local industry is poised to take advantage of the global growth in playing games and the realisation that games have provided a vital source of connection, enjoyment, education and wellbeing during the pandemic. We at the IGEA expect to see the video game industry contribute further to the Australian economy with the commitment to the provision of appropriate funding levers provided by all levels of government.

“While we congratulate the Government for introducing the DGTO, we continue to work with them to see the return of a fund similar to the cancelled Australian Game Development Fund, to garner support for our high potential independent development sector.”

About the Australian Game Development Survey (AGDS)

The Australian Game Development Survey is an independent survey undertaken in 2021 for IGEA by Bond University. The 2020-2021 survey was based on financial year data from 1 July 2020 to 30 June 2021. The survey opened in September 2021 and closed at the end of November 2021. One hundred eighty-seven studios completed the survey and 400 were contacted to participate. Respondents were required to have an ABN and to have made or currently make video games.

World of Warships Raises $129,757 for Save the Children in 24-Hour Christmas Charity Livestream

All proceeds will be donated from the jam-packed live stream, sales of their Christmas Charity Bundle, and an additional matched donation from Wargaming

AUSTIN, TEXAS (December 13, 2021) — Today Wargaming, developer and publisher of the hit naval combat games, World of Warships and World of Warships: Legends, has revealed it raised $129,757 for Save the Children through a 24-hour Christmas charity livestream. As part of Wargaming’s ongoing partnership with global humanitarian organization, Save the Children, the event held on World of Warships’ official Twitch channel was packed with dozens of activities including Twitch drops, funny challenges, special guests, and games. Funds were also raised from sales of the Christmas Charity Bundle, which Wargaming matched dollar for dollar. 

The variety livestream brought together auctions for rare ships and in-game goodies that the audience could take part in, alongside interactive games, quizzes, as well as an action-packed sea battles. The event was hosted by a rotation of World of Warships and World of Warships: Legends staff, who went through a host of comedy challenges all in the name of charity. During the stream, World of Warships players directly donated over $45,000 USD, which, including the charity bundles, was matched by Wargaming with an equal donation. 

Those who want to contribute to the grand total can still do so by purchasing the Christmas Charity Bundle, which is still available from the World of Warships Premium Shop the 20th of December and includes a special patch and flag, combined with a bevy of camouflages to jazz up their fleet in World of Warships. All proceeds from the sales will be donated to Save the Children. 

This is part of an ongoing partnership between Wargaming and Save the Children, which has seen a total of 217,000 being raised over Christmas charity events over the past 3 years.
